Raúl Torrez was sworn in as the 32nd New Mexico Attorney General in January 2023. Prior to election, AG Torrez served as the Bernalillo County District Attorney from 2017 to 2022. Earlier in his career he worked as an assistant district attorney and assistant attorney general. He was then appointed to serve as a White House Fellow by President Barack Obama and served as a senior advisor to the Department of Justice.

The AG is an elected position in New Mexico.

  • Next Election:November 3, 2026
  • Election Process:Elected
  • Term/Limit:4 years / two consecutive terms
